I think Cavendish bananas are horrible once they get any brown at all on the skin. They have like a 24-36 hour window where they're heavenly to my taste buds (when the last of the green is disappearing from them up till they turn totally yellow); any earlier and they have a nasty 'green' taste to them, any later and they get soft/mealy and oversweet. One day often makes the difference between tasting great and tasting unpleasant.
For my tastes, the locally grown one is right on the edge of going bad, while the imported one is way past being edible for eating out-of-hand.
